Dear Colleagues,
We look for reviews of new books for children in Books for Keeps,
Carousel, Child Education, Children's Literature in Education, English &
Media Magazine, Junior Education, Language Matters, Reading Research
Quarterly, School Librarian, Signal and Times Educational Supplement.
